Agilent gel permeation chromatography (GPC) and size exclusion chromatography (SEC) columns and standards have been the top-selling in the polymer industry for over 40 years. GPC and SEC is used to determine the molecular weight and size distribution of macromolecules. SEC and GPC columns generate accurate, reliable data for critical polymer parameters, including dispersity (PDI), molecular weight mass average (Mw), number average (Mn), and z-average (Mz).
